To reduce EMI, it is recommended that unshielded low-voltage circuits be separated from power circuits by a minimum distance of:

A. 2"
B. 12"
C. 24"
D. 36"



Answer :

3. From the information provided, the recommended minimum distance for separating unshielded low-voltage circuits from power circuits is 12 inches.

Therefore, the correct answer is:
b. 12"
